Canada and the United states have many similarities and differences. They are two of the largest countries in the world. The governments of both Canada and the United States are Democratic, although their styles of government are very different. French and English are the primary languages of Canada while in the United States English is the official language. Many services in the United states are also provided in Spanish because of its large Hispanic population.
